A Pallet Shuttle Guide Rail is a key component installed inside radio shuttle pallet racking lanes to provide a stable running path for pallet shuttle carts. It helps guide the shuttle cart during automatic pallet storage and retrieval operations, ensuring smooth movement and accurate positioning inside deep storage channels.
Manufactured from high-strength steel, the guide rail works with the shuttle cart, pallet support rails, and rack structure to ensure reliable operation in heavy-duty warehouse conditions.
Main Functions
- Provides a precise running track for pallet shuttle carts
- Reduces shuttle deviation during pallet loading and unloading
- Improves operational stability in deep-lane storage systems
- Supports efficient high-density warehouse storage applications

Technical Specifications of Pallet Shuttle Guide Rail
Designed for Radio Shuttle Racking Systems
The pallet shuttle guide rail is engineered to provide stable guidance for automatic shuttle carts in deep-lane pallet storage systems.
Specifications can be customized according to rack depth, shuttle cart requirements, pallet dimensions, and warehouse operating conditions.
| Product Name | Pallet Shuttle Guide Rail |
| Material | High Strength Steel |
| Application | Radio Shuttle Pallet Racking System |
| Compatible Shuttle Load | 1500kg – 2000kg Pallet Shuttle Cart |
| Rail Thickness | 3.0 – 5.0 mm |
| Surface Treatment | Powder Coated / Galvanized |
| Customization | Available |
